What is Private Practice?
Private practice refers to doctor, including psychiatrists, who run separately instead of as part of a bigger company, such as a health center or clinic. These professionals maintain their practices and offer customized care to their clients.
Advantages of Private Practice
There are numerous benefits to seeking mental health treatment in a private practice setting:

Personalized Care: Private practice psychiatrists often have a lower patient load, which permits them to supply customized treatment plans and more individualized attention.

Greater Flexibility: Due to their self-reliance, psychiatrists in private practice often have more versatility in scheduling appointments, which can accommodate a patient's busy life.

Boosted Privacy: Private practices normally use a more confidential setting, reassuring clients worried about personal privacy when talking about delicate issues.

Comprehensive Treatment Options: Many psychiatrists in private practice provide a variety of treatment options, consisting of psychotherapy, counseling, and medication management.

Structure Long-Term Relationships: Patients have the chance to establish a relationship with their psychiatrist over time, which can boost the restorative alliance and enable much deeper discussions about mental health.

What is the difference between a psychiatrist and a psychologist?
While both professionals focus on mental health, psychiatrists are medical doctors who can prescribe medication and may incorporate medical treatments into their approach. Psychologists usually supply treatment and therapy however can not prescribe medications.
2. How do I know if I require to see a psychiatrist?
Indications that you may require to see a psychiatrist consist of relentless sensations of sadness or anxiety, problem working in every day life, mood swings, drug abuse problems, and any significant modifications in behavior.
3. What kinds of treatments can I expect from a psychiatrist?
Psychiatrists provide a range of treatments, from medication management to various types of treatment, including cognitive behavior modification (CBT), dialectical behavior modification (DBT), and supportive treatment.
4. The length of time does treatment usually take?
The period of treatment varies based upon specific scenarios. Some might need just a couple of sessions, while others might require ongoing therapy for months or perhaps years.
